Dust Seals for Helicopter Bearing Assemblies |
|
Dust seal rings, custom molded from Nitrile elastomeric compounds and bonded to G-10 fiberglass, are made by
Pelmor® Laboratories, Inc. to stringent specifications for use in helicopter precision rotor bearing assemblies.
Due to the extremely close tolerance requirements of these dust seals, their production requires a number of
special considerations by the manufacturer. These include the use of a specially developed polymeric formulation
that bonds well to G-10 fiberglass, and precision in both the engineering stage and the molding operation to ensure
that the bearing assembly components are adequately protected in the field.
Incorporated into the main rotor bearing assembly of a variety of commercial and military helicopters, the dust seals
are subjected to many aggressive elements. The Nitrile elastomer was selected because of its ability to withstand
temperature extremes of -50° to +250° F and to resist attack by over 750 corrosive oils, chemicals, and
other liquids. Other properties include excellent abrasion resistance; tensile strength of 2030 psi; Shore A durometer
of 60+/- 5; and 385% elongation.
Pelmor® offers a number of capabilities that are crucial to the production of high quality dust seal rings including:
an in-house molding press which can manufacture components as large as 44", while maintaining tolerances on the
part’s diameter as tight as +/- .010" and a thickness as close as +/- .003"; accurate secondary trim operations;
and superior machining of the G-10 fiberglass from sheet stock. The long-lasting bonding of rubber to other substrates,
such as G-10 fiberglass, is another specialty of Pelmor® Laboratories.
